firebase realtime chat flutter

you can also search friend on app and send them invitation to chat with you If they accept your invitation enjoy chatting. Campus Chat App made in Flutter and Firebase 11 February . The platform is open source, unlike Firebase, whose platform doesn't offer all services for free to start. If you are a beginner in Flutter, then you can check my blog, Create a first app in Flutter. I did this project to learn Flutter and for better understanding of its state management architectures. First, before using phone authentication we need to do the following three steps: Enable SafetyNet, when you navigate to the link you will see the following: All you have to do is click enabled. Learn iOS, Swift, Android, Kotlin, Flutter and Dart development and unlock our massive catalog of 50+ books and 4,000+ videos. Integrated with Firebase Backend. Implementing the Real-Time Web Chat UI. Learn more. The code you copied from Firebase console will only have firebase-app.js. and when they exit the chat room I set the value as a false. Connect the app to your Firebase Project from your Firebase Console and add the google-services.json in the /android/app directory. Well if you are building a Firebase chat app that login via Google Account, then consider the below-mentioned plugins. By default, this allows you to interact with the Realtime Database using the default Firebase App used whilst installing FlutterFire on your platform. Next, you will create the main script of your client-side app to integrate both Auth0 and Firebase together to build your real-time web chat. Firebase provides us a variety of products Authentication, Realtime Database, Cloud Firestore, Cloud Storage, Cloud Functions, Firebase Hosting, ML Kit. We are using Flutter WebRTC for peer to peer connections and communications. Isi Form sesuai Name Package yang ada di projek , Untuk SHA 1 optional jika di isi ini caranya : Refresh Gradlenya. The Firebase Realtime Database is a cloud-hosted database. Flutter Firebase Chat is a real-time messaging application built on Flutter, Firebase, and Agora.io that supports video calling. Data is stored as JSON and synchronized in realtime to every connected client. This brings us to the following screen:: Add project at Firebase Console. It's straightforward, so cheers to the Flutter team. How to use the Firebase Local Emulator Suite to develop an Android app with Firebase. I'm going with Chatty. A full table of pricing can be found on the Firebase website. Create your own chat Application similar to whats App. It is easy-to-use, streamlined and highly superior with attractive user interface and smooth navigation. The Realtime database allows up to 100 simultaneous connections and 1-gigabyte storage/month. Flutter-Bloc-Firebase-Chat Example This project is based on the following two articles below. Trong bi vit ny, Bo Flutter s hng dn chi tit v Firebase v FireStore v cch thit lp Firebase vi Flutter Project. Step 2: Create Users list page. The goal is to demonstrate essential patterns when working connecting Firebase users to their data in a Flutter app. Now, download the google-services.json file and place this file in the android/app/ folder. 8. You can send notifications from the Firebase Cloud Messaging console directly. Flutter: Firebase Realtime messy chat. The course content is very robust and covers several advanced concepts and topics ranging from Firebase Database and Authentication to Notifications and so much more. In other words, we can say that it is a web service . . Go to firebase.google.com and create a new Firebase project. According to the Flutter Fire documentation, you can now initialize Firebase directly from Dart. All you need to do is to install the application and start using it. Users get real-time updates about typing, recording, sent messages, and more. Langkah 4: Tambahkan plugin Firebase. If however you'd like to use it with a secondary Firebase App, use the instanceFor method: FirebaseApp secondaryApp = Firebase.app('SecondaryApp'); Flutter Firebase Chat Course Learn how to build a realtime chat app using Flutter and Firebase. This is a real-time chat app made with firebase. Firebase RealTime Database l mt c s d liu NoSQL di dng lu tr m my cho php bn lu tr v ng b d liu . Hello I would Like to get data from my server with rest api by default and when . The platform is self-hosted, and the source code is available on Github. Ask Question Asked 4 years, 1 month ago. Contributors. Setup Create a Flutter App Create an app with the Flutter CLI. For now, you can setup the database in test mode. I am building a dating app, and I wanted to (obviously) build some chat functionality into it. A raywenderlich.com subscription is the best way to learn and master mobile development plans start at just $19.99/month! One low price. Flutter Chat App. This android flutter chat app with firebase is perfect if you are looking for a messenger app that serves communication purposes. dependent packages 8 total releases 19 most recent commit 6 months ago. Realtime communication platform; In app chat; Alerts and notifications; Pricing plans are detailed below: . Flutter Agency is one of the most popular online portals dedicated to Flutter Technology and daily thousands of unique visitors come to this portal to enhance their knowledge on Flutter. In the previous section we have learned that Flutter and Firebase can work together. Afterwards I almost completely refactored it by adding bloc pattern, GetIt Library and other code optimizations. Click on the Register app button. Password : 123. Step 1: The ChatUser model. Setelah Create New Projek lalu akan di alihakan he halaman seperti berikut, Lalu pilih yang di tengah Add Firebase to your android app. Let's create one and see how to integrate the realtime database with an example app. Rowy 3,513. Chattin is a Real-Time complete chatting app with built using Flutter and Firebase. Once the setup is complete you'll be taken to a screen which has an option to add Firebase to your app, select the "Web" option and follow the prompts. An Android Emulator with Android 5.0+. Flutter 2.8 & Firebase Chat App with Push NotificationsLearn & Build iOS + Android Real Time Messenger Application with Provider & Google Cloud Firebase Functions, MessagingRating: 3.2 out of 566 reviews5.5 total hours38 lecturesExpertCurrent price: $14.99Original price: $19.99. Appwrite is an open-source Firebase alternative specially designed for Flutter developers. The most important aspect of building a messaging app is to learn to set up Firebase for iOS apps and to save the chat data into the database. FireApp Chat is an Android chat app code template for anyone looking to create a platform that's filled with features. In a nutshell, Firebase helps us focus on the front-end of our applications while it does the hidden jobs for us. And Firebase acts as backend. Update V1.1 - Firebase Push Notifications with Foreground & Background Messages I'm creating an application with flutter, I use the realtime firebase plugin. The last thing you will need to do to complete your real-time chat app is to create a new file called index. F irebase is an amazing platform developed by Google to connect mobile and web applications and help developers to improve, build, and grow their apps. Flutter Firebase Chat is a real time chatting app with video calling support based on Flutter, Firebase, and Agora.io. Disable the Google Analytics as this isn't required. Firebase . Click on the Next button and add the lines in the mentioned files to . 4 Steps to Develop a Chat App in Flutter with Firebase Create a Project in Firebase Connect Firebase to Your Flutter App Install Plugins Create the Screen Layouts Log-in Screen Home Screen Profile. Now, let's create our chat rooms component. Plugin Firebase Realtime: https://pub.dartlang . Yusuf Tr. Firebase gives a generous free tier for Authentication and the Realtime Database. Step 2 Now, you need to set up a project in Google Firebase. video calls and Audio calls and connects through firebase database. The portal is full of cool resources from Flutter like Flutter Widget Guide, Flutter Projects, Code libs and etc. Yusuf is the lead iOS engineer . Flutter Sending a Text to Other Users | Flutter Chat App with Firebase | Realtime Chat App | Part 10 Firebase can be defined as a service that acts as a backend provider. You will learn a lot of stuff regarding Flutter in this Flutter chat app series. To complete the setup we need to add . Karena Flutter adalah framework multi-platform, setiap plugin Firebase berlaku untuk platform Apple, Android, dan web. Full source code. Google Sign-In (Example) Image Source: https://pub.dev/packages . it is <UserId,bool>. Build an UBER Clone App Using Flutter and Firebase (2020) This course is designed to be a complete reference guide to building a fully functional Uber clone app using flutter .Search no further for a complete learning pack. Also you can easily customize and refine it for yourself, since it uses a BLoC pattern. Authentication is free for the authentication providers we'll be covering (email/password, Google and GitHub). you can also search friend on app and send them invitation to chat with you If they accept your invitation enjoy chatting. Firebase l g ? So, let's begin our app. Whoxa works with a real-time chat and also supports audio-video calls. Ideal Plugins for chat app development: Firebase Auth for Flutter. With the new release of Flutter RealTime Chat, you can now: - Chat with one person at a time or in groups - Share images and videos with your friends As a result, together they work as a full stack app. In this Angular 9 tutorial, we will gonna show you a chat web app that uses Firebase Realtime-Database. . You can sign up & sign in, search for users by their unique username, upload personal avatar, text and receive messages in real time, and enjoy modern UI design. Rowy is an open-source low-code platform for Firebase and Firestore. When you build cross-platform apps Flutter & Firebase, all of your clients can share one Realtime Database instance and automatically receive updates with the newest data. Cool chat is developed in flutter which use firebase as realtime database for chat. Introducing Firebase Realtime Database Cool chat is developed in flutter which use firebase as realtime . Either way, click continue to proceed and Firebase will take a few seconds to delegate resources for the project. In your firebase console, goto "Database" tab from left menu and click on "Realtime Database". Firebase is a back-end platform provided by Google for building full-stack applications. Coding Cafe. Chat A template for the chat app using firebase real time database. You can choose to add analytics to your project, but it's not required. I have added google-services.json and everything just like how its specified in SDK instructions while creating Firebase android app in FIrebase project. It's a great option for a chat app using Firebase. multiple groups chat, and you can send an image, videos, audios with advanced call features i.e. Enter your project name, disable Google Analytics for now, and click on the Create Project button. Demo Features: 1.Personal Chat 2.Group Chat 1. 1. Follow the below steps for that. Click Real-time Database and select Create Database. For a small Flutter app, Firebase is free. Once logged into your account goto the console and add a new project called "Realtime Chat". These plugins will offer you user info, real-time data for messaging and uploading a picture. This is my app level build.gradle file Fast-track your Flutter and Firebase learning with practical tips and proven techniques. I set the value $ {userId} : true. Let's Create. LiveChat - Realtime Communication App is a flutter based chat application that enables fast communication through text messages and video & voice calling features. Create a chat application with Flutter & Firebase.Click here to Subscribe to Johannes Milke: https://www.youtube.com/JohannesMilke?sub_confirmation=1- Source. js inside . In order to send Push Notification ,We need to create a firebase project for the Firebase Cloud Messaging from firebase.google.com by logging in with your google account. But you will also need firebase-database.js in order to use database. Whoxa v2.0.4 - Whatsapp Clone flutter App with Firebase (Audio/Video call) Whoxa is a WhatsApp clone app. First off, head over to the Firebase Console and click the "Add project" option. 2. Linking The Flutter Chat App With Firebase After a successful layout of various screens, you are finally done with the final structure using Google Firebase firestore. 3.2 (66) Java 7 or higher. Setting Up a Firebase Realtime Database Anda mengakses Firebase di aplikasi Flutter melalui berbagai plugin Firebase Flutter, satu plugin untuk setiap produk Firebase (misalnya: Cloud Firestore, Authentication, Analytics, dll.). Firepad 3,695. Go to the Cloud Messaging section from the left menu of the project overview page and click Send your first message: Enter a notification title, text, and name, then click Next: / src / public / app and insert the . This template not only supports chat, but voice and video calls as well. We provide you with the full source code of our video & voice calling app in Flutter, so you can add a complete chat functionality to any mobile app that is coded in Flutter. The user can read a realtime feed of recent chat messages via Firestore and post new messages into the chat. Hussain Mustafa. Let's look at the steps to develop a chat app in flutter with firebase. Viewed 3k times Part of Google Cloud Collective 2 1. Cool Chat is chat application in which you can use text, images, videos and emojis to chat with friends. For chat we have used flutter firebase, this app can also be used as a chat app. Developer $299. Install Firebase Click on Add Project Button (+) initiating firebase project creation process. Output Plugin Required Firebase Realtime Database It is a cloud-hosted database that causes us to store and sync information with a NoSQL database in real-time to each associated client platforms like Android, iOS, and Web. The user can login through email or google and can send images & files to peers. Chattin is a Real-Time complete chatting app with built using Flutter and Firebase. Build a complete, real-world app with Flutter, Firebase and Dart. You can run this app on both platforms: Android and iOS. Ci t Firebase command line tools: npm install -g firebase-tools ng nhp vo ti khon Firebase: firebase login cd n floder project ca bn v khi to mt firebase project: firebase init Sau khi chnh sa li code ngon ngh, deploy firebase project bn g command: firebase deploy 2. but the problem is , if they close the app in the chat room, there is no way to set the value as false. I have followed every guidelines for authenticating to firebase. Provider State Management Package. . Our mobile app is fully functional, ready to be used in production right away. Article (30 mins . I have created an app named "flutter_chat_app". Personal $99. Contribute to MuhammadAnas452111/Flutter_chat_app development by creating an account on GitHub. Flutter Web If want to run Flutter-Chat project, on web Go to App, Firebase->Settings and then add new app, web Follow the instructions, Put the firebaseConfig script on index.html in web folder, Enjoy Fluttering Run flutter run (remember to open simulator or connect physical device, iOS auto run additional command pod install) flutter run --release Beginners Guide This project is a starting point for a Flutter application. Chat app in Flutter & Dart. total releases 6 most recent commit 12 hours . To. Add this code to components/Rooms/Rooms. These days NoSQL databases are picking up ubiquity, and Firebase Realtime Database is one of the NoSQL databases. Write iOS & Android apps with a single codebase using Flutter and Dart. Airtable-like UI with cloud functions workflows in JS/TS, all in your browser. Angela Yu's course does cover a group chat app, and the Firebase backend of the app was remarkably simple to implement. Select the country where the data will be stored, and then select Start in test mode. Final Words In this article,. Media will be stored in your server. Chat App Data Structure In Firebase Firestore Pagination In Flutter Using Firebase Cloud Firestore Upload Image File To Firebase Storage Using Flutter I have divided the chat app series into multiple articles. Modified 4 years, 1 month ago. Plus, you get real-time queries, unlike Firebase, whose queries are slow, and you're not locked into a particular vendor or Google Cloud framework. if the user is in the chat room I mean ,they enter the chat room. Flutter chat app with firebase , provider and api with all chat app functions 08 August 2022. Firebase Project Setup Steps Step 1 The first and most basic step is to create a new application in Flutter. Enable Phone Authentication in Firebase. Create a new project from File New Flutter Project with your development IDE. Flutter Tutorial: Login, Role, and Permissions (1825) Spring Boot, Security, and Data MongoDB Authentication Example (1761) In fact, Flutter works as the frontend. This app supports Android and iOS platforms. A template for the chat app using firebase real time database 25 June 2022. Flutter and Firebase integration Following these steps will connect firebase chat on Android: Sign up with your Google account or log in with your Firebase account. Money back guaranteed. Main features: One-to-one chatting; Group chatting; One-to-one video calling via . Group chats, photo & video messages, push notifications. Creating a new Project. Prerequisites Have Flutter installed Intermediate knowledge of Flutter and Dart Recorded 22 Lessons Runtime 3h 13m Launch Club Pro Unlimited access to all existing and future courses Join our private Discord server Access to all source code

Cheapest Investment Platform Uk, Hanover Manor Patio Furniture, Phd In London School Of Economics, Rancho Rs9000xl Shock, Ipsec Site-to-site Vpn Configuration On Cisco Asa,

firebase realtime chat flutter